ACCC v INFO4PC.COM Pty Ltd [2001] FCA 258 PRACTICE AND PROCEDURE – affidavit – filed in present proceeding – application by party for leave for use by non-party in second proceeding – whether leave should be granted – consideration of circumstances relevant to grant
Federal Court Rules O 46 r 6(3) Springfield Nominees Pty Limited v Bridgelands Securities Limited (1992) 38 FCR 217, applied Crest Homes PLC v Marks [1987] AC 829, considered Holpitt Pty Ltd v Varimu Pty Ltd (1991) 29 FCR 576, considered Sweetman v Australian Thoroughbred Finance Pty Ltd (Lockhart J, 23 July 1992, unreported), considered Complete Technology Pty Ltd v Toshiba (Australia) Pty Ltd (1994) 124 ALR 493, considered Autodesk Australia Pty Ltd v Dyason (1994) 30 IPR 469, considered Re Addstone Pty Ltd (in liq); Ex parte Macks (1998) 30 ACSR 156 and 162, considered AUSTRALIAN COMPETITION AND CONSUMER COMMISSION v INFO4PC.COM PTY LTD and JAMES HAMILTON RAE S 17 of 2001 RD NICHOLSON J 15 MARCH 2001 PERTH

THE COURT ORDERS THAT: Upon the Ministry of Fair Trading (Western Australia) undertaking to the Court not to use the following document or the information in it for any purpose other than evidence in the proceeding CIV 2738 of 2000 in the Supreme Court of Western Australia: 1. The applicant's motion date 22 February 2001 be granted. 2. The applicant have leave to provide that Ministry with the affidavit of James Hamilton Rae dated 13 February 2001 filed in this proceeding.
